US-Iran relations have been strained for decades. Recent US strikes on Iranian facilities have brought back memories of a pivotal 47-year-old event.
📌 Key Points
The 1979 Tehran hostage crisis, where US embassy staff were held for over a year, remains a deep scar. The US cited this history to justify its strong response to current threats.
💡 Why It Matters
Conflict in the Middle East often leads to higher oil prices. This can cause inflation, increasing the cost of living and daily expenses for everyone.
